XIR169990 Vianden through a Spiders Web (pencil, Indian ink, sepia and w/c on paper) by Hugo, Victor (1802-85); Maison de Victor Hugo, Paris, France; (add.info.: Vianden a travers une toile d araignee; Vianden is a medieval 11th century castle in Luxembourg; ); French, out of copyright

Vianden through a Spider's Web - A Captivating Glimpse into Medieval Splendor

EDITORS COMMENTS
. This mesmerizing print, created by the renowned artist Victor Hugo, transports us to the enchanting world of Vianden Castle in Luxembourg. The delicate and intricate details captured in this artwork are truly awe-inspiring. Using a combination of pencil, Indian ink, sepia, and watercolor on paper, Hugo skillfully portrays the castle as seen through a spider's web. The fine lines and subtle shading create an ethereal effect that adds depth and dimension to the composition. Vianden Castle itself is a magnificent 11th-century fortress steeped in history. Its towering turrets and sturdy stone walls evoke images of knights and fair maidens from times long past. Through this unique perspective offered by the spider's web, we gain a fresh appreciation for its grandeur. The juxtaposition of fragility represented by the delicate threads of the spider's web against the enduring strength of Vianden Castle creates an intriguing contrast. It reminds us that even amidst vulnerability, beauty can be found. Hugo's artistic prowess shines through as he captures not only architectural precision but also evokes emotions with his choice of medium. This print serves as both a visual delight and an invitation to explore our imagination. Displayed at Maison de Victor Hugo in Paris, France, this artwork invites viewers to delve into their own interpretations while appreciating one man's creative vision.
